Important Materials
What are these additives made of? Here’s what to know:
- Base Oils: These are the main ingredients. They can be mineral oil, synthetic oil, or a mix. Synthetic oils are often the best.
- Detergents: These are cleaning agents. They help remove gunk.
- Dispersants: These keep the gunk from sticking. They keep it suspended in the oil so the filter can catch it.
- Anti-Wear Agents: These reduce friction. They are often chemicals like zinc dialkyldithiophosphate (ZDDP).
- Viscosity Index Improvers: These help the oil work in different temperatures.
